游戏服务器是啥意思啊,深入解析游戏服务器,揭秘其运作原理与重要性
- 综合资讯
- 2024-11-30 08:28:19
- 2

游戏服务器是指为玩家提供游戏环境、数据存储和交互的平台。其运作原理涉及硬件、网络和软件的协同工作,保障游戏顺畅进行。游戏服务器的重要性在于确保玩家之间的实时互动、数据安...
游戏服务器是指为玩家提供游戏环境、数据存储和交互的平台。其运作原理涉及硬件、网络和软件的协同工作,保障游戏顺畅进行。游戏服务器的重要性在于确保玩家之间的实时互动、数据安全与游戏平衡。
随着互联网的普及,网络游戏已成为人们生活中不可或缺的一部分,而游戏服务器作为网络游戏的核心,承载着玩家们的游戏体验,游戏服务器究竟是什么?它又是如何运作的呢?本文将为您深入解析游戏服务器,带您了解其运作原理与重要性。
游戏服务器的定义
游戏服务器,顾名思义,是指为网络游戏提供数据存储、计算和通信服务的计算机系统,它主要负责将游戏数据从服务器传输到客户端,以及处理客户端的请求,保证游戏的正常运行。
游戏服务器的类型
1、客户端-服务器(C/S)架构
客户端-服务器架构是游戏服务器中最常见的类型,在这种架构下,客户端负责与用户进行交互,服务器负责处理游戏逻辑和数据存储,客户端将用户的操作发送到服务器,服务器处理后再将结果反馈给客户端。
2、服务器-客户端(S/C)架构
服务器-客户端架构与客户端-服务器架构类似,只是两者的角色发生了颠倒,在这种架构下,服务器负责与用户进行交互,客户端负责处理游戏逻辑和数据存储。
3、对等网络(P2P)架构
对等网络架构是一种去中心化的游戏服务器架构,在这种架构下,每个玩家既是客户端,又是服务器,玩家之间直接进行数据交换,无需依赖中心服务器。
游戏服务器的运作原理
1、数据传输
游戏服务器通过数据传输协议,如TCP/IP,将游戏数据从服务器传输到客户端,客户端接收到数据后,将其渲染成可视化的游戏画面。
2、数据处理
游戏服务器负责处理游戏逻辑和数据存储,当客户端发送请求时,服务器根据游戏规则进行处理,并将结果反馈给客户端。
3、用户管理
游戏服务器负责管理用户账号、角色、权限等信息,用户登录游戏时,服务器验证其身份,并为其分配角色。
4、安全防护
游戏服务器需要具备一定的安全防护能力,以防止黑客攻击、作弊等行为,常见的安全防护措施包括数据加密、防火墙、入侵检测等。
游戏服务器的重要性
1、保证游戏流畅度
游戏服务器能够实时处理大量玩家的操作,确保游戏的流畅度,在高峰时段,服务器可以自动调整资源分配,保证游戏的稳定运行。
2、提高游戏体验
游戏服务器为玩家提供稳定的网络连接,减少延迟和卡顿,提高游戏体验。
3、防止作弊与外挂
游戏服务器可以实时监控玩家的行为,防止作弊和外挂,维护游戏的公平性。
4、拓展游戏功能
游戏服务器可以支持丰富的游戏功能,如多人在线、角色扮演、竞技对战等,满足不同玩家的需求。
游戏服务器作为网络游戏的核心,承载着玩家们的游戏体验,了解游戏服务器的运作原理与重要性,有助于我们更好地享受游戏带来的乐趣,在未来,随着技术的不断发展,游戏服务器将更加智能化、高效化,为玩家带来更加优质的网络游戏体验。
本文链接:https://zhitaoyun.cn/1207495.html
发表评论